**South America Radial Artery Compression Devices Market Drivers**

**Increasing Cardiovascular Procedures**

The rise in cardiovascular diseases in South America is a significant driver for the South America Radial Artery Compression Devices Market Industry. According to the Pan American Health Organization, cardiovascular diseases are projected to be the leading cause of death in the region, accounting for over 30% of all deaths. Studies show a steady increase in invasive cardiovascular procedures, particularly percutaneous coronary interventions, which have seen a surge of approximately 8% annually over the past five years.

Major organizations, including the Brazilian Society of Cardiology, are actively promoting awareness and patient education regarding the benefits of these procedures, leading to greater adoption of radial artery compression devices.

**Radial Artery Compression Devices Market Product Type Insights**

The South America Radial Artery Compression Devices Market has been notably influenced by various product types, primarily Band/Strap Based Devices, Knob-Based Devices, and Plate-Based Devices. Each of these types holds distinct functionalities and benefits, leading to a dynamic market landscape. Band/Strap Based Devices are particularly favored for their ease of use and efficient application process, making them popular among healthcare professionals in medical settings. 

This segment is significant as it caters to a wide range of patients and procedures, allowing for timely interventions.On the other hand, Knob-Based Devices have gained traction due to their precise compression control, which is crucial in minimizing complications during procedures involving the radial artery. Their design allows for better adjustability, making them preferred in complex cases. Plate-Based Devices, while being a less conventional choice, are gaining attention for their stability and enhanced performance in providing consistent pressure.

### Brazil : Strong Demand and Growth Drivers

Brazil holds a dominant 25.0% market share in the radial artery-compression-devices sector, driven by increasing cardiovascular procedures and a growing elderly population. The demand is further supported by government initiatives aimed at improving healthcare infrastructure and access to advanced medical technologies. Regulatory policies are becoming more favorable, promoting innovation and investment in the healthcare sector, which is crucial for sustaining growth in this market.

### Mexico : Regulatory Support and Urban Demand

Mexico accounts for 10.5% of the South American market, with growth fueled by urbanization and increasing healthcare expenditure. The government is implementing policies to enhance healthcare access, which is expected to boost demand for radial artery-compression devices. The rising prevalence of chronic diseases is also driving consumption patterns, as more patients require advanced medical interventions.

### Argentina : Healthcare Investments and Urban Centers

Argentina holds a 12.0% market share, characterized by steady growth in the radial artery-compression-devices market. Key growth drivers include increased healthcare investments and a focus on improving medical facilities in urban centers like Buenos Aires and Córdoba. Regulatory frameworks are evolving to support the introduction of innovative medical technologies, enhancing market dynamics and consumer access.
